Freshman Basketball with Brown

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The Freshman basketball team will play the Brown freshmen in the Hemenway Gymnasium this evening at 8 o'clock. Captain Stebbins is ill and his place at left guard will be taken by C. Browne. The Brown team was defeated, 30 to 22, in its first game last Saturday by Dean Academy. The Freshman team is light, but passes well, and is less individual in its work than Brown.
